Profile bio

About Lucky Tran

Dr. Lucky Tran is a biomedical scientist and a Director of Science Communication at Columbia University. As a public health communicator, Dr. Tran has appeared in the media, trained scientists and physicians on how to speak to the media, and helped organize several COVID advocacy groups.Dr. Tran is a leader in science advocacy who has trained and mobilized millions of scientists. As a steering committee member, Lucky was one of the founders of the March for Science, the largest day of science advocacy in history, with over one million participants in over 600 cities worldwide. Dr. Tran is passionate about the intersections of climate change and health, and has attended several UN climate conferences, organized many large actions and marches including the People’s Climate March, and is a Grist 50 Fixer. Dr. Tran is an author of the book Science Not Silence, and his writing has been published in The Washington Post, The Guardian, Scientific American and more.Dr. Tran studied microbes during his PhD at the University of Cambridge, and completed his postdoc at Cornell University. Dr. Tran is a refugee who grew up in Australia and now lives in New York.
